物聯網MQTT 協議憑借其輕量級、低功耗、發(fā)布/訂閱模式等特性,成為智能家居、工業(yè)監(jiān)控等場景的通信基石。然而,如何高效測試 MQTT 服務的穩(wěn)定性與可靠性,成為開發(fā)者面臨的挑戰(zhàn)。傳統測試工具往往局限于 HTTP 協議,而 Postman 作為一款全協議支持的開發(fā)工具,正以“MQTT 調試神器”的新身份,重新定義物聯網測試的邊界。
智能家居,設備間的無縫通信是核心命脈。燈光隨指令自動調節(jié)、溫濕度傳感器實時反饋、安防系統遠程警報……這些場景的背后,離不開高效可靠的通信協議支撐。而MQTT(Message Queuing Telemetry Transport),憑借其輕量級、低功耗、支持發(fā)布/訂閱模式的特性,已成為智能家居領域的“通信語言”。本文將以實踐為導向,手把手教你用簡單幾步搭建MQTT服務,為智能家居項目注入“智慧大腦”。
在數字化浪潮席卷全球的今天,數據已成為企業(yè)決策的核心驅動力。從用戶行為追蹤到供應鏈優(yōu)化,從市場趨勢預測到風險管控,數據的價值正以前所未有的速度被挖掘。然而,面對海量、多源、異構的數據,傳統IT架構已難以滿足高效處理與分析的需求。云計算與大數據技術的融合,為這一難題提供了破局之道——通過彈性擴展的計算資源、分布式存儲架構與智能分析工具,企業(yè)能夠快速搭建起靈活、高效、低成本的大數據分析平臺。本文將從實踐角度出發(fā),結合技術選型、架構設計、實施步驟與優(yōu)化策略,為企業(yè)提供一份可落地的搭建指南。
物聯網(IoT)技術的快速發(fā)展正深刻改變著傳統行業(yè),從工業(yè)制造到智慧城市,從智能家居到農業(yè)監(jiān)測,設備間的實時數據交互成為核心需求。MQTT協議憑借其輕量級、低功耗和發(fā)布/訂閱模式的優(yōu)勢,成為物聯網通信的主流協議之一。本文將詳細介紹如何基于MQTT協議搭建一套完整的物聯網平臺,涵蓋基礎架構設計、核心組件實現、安全機制及典型應用場景。
物聯網(IoT)和工業(yè)互聯網快速發(fā)展,MQTT協議因其輕量級、低帶寬消耗和發(fā)布/訂閱模式,成為設備間通信的核心協議。然而,隨著MQTT應用場景的復雜化,手動測試已難以滿足高效驗證需求,尤其是在多設備并發(fā)、異常場景模擬和性能基準測試等方面。本文將詳細介紹如何基于Python搭建一套完整的MQTT自動化測試框架,并分享其在真實項目中的實踐案例。
在物聯網(IoT),MQTT協議憑借其輕量級、低功耗和發(fā)布/訂閱模式的優(yōu)勢,已成為設備間通信的核心紐帶。然而,當開發(fā)者需要在Windows、Linux或macOS上搭建MQTT服務器時,操作系統的底層差異會直接影響部署效率、性能表現和運維體驗。本文將從安裝流程、性能調優(yōu)、安全配置和生態(tài)兼容性四個維度,深度解析三大操作系統的MQTT搭建差異。
物聯網(IoT)爆發(fā)式增長,MQTT協議憑借其輕量級、低功耗和發(fā)布/訂閱模式的優(yōu)勢,已成為設備間通信的核心協議。然而,面對EMQX、Mosquitto、ActiveMQ等主流MQTT服務器,開發(fā)者如何根據業(yè)務需求選擇最適合的方案?本文通過真實測試數據與場景分析,為你揭示不同服務器的性能差異與選型邏輯。
物聯網(IoT)與Web應用深度融合,MQTT協議憑借其輕量級、低功耗的特性,已成為設備間通信的核心協議。然而,如何確保MQTT消息在Web端的可靠傳輸與交互?如何通過自動化測試驗證復雜場景下的業(yè)務邏輯?Selenium與MQTT的結合,為這一難題提供了創(chuàng)新解決方案——通過Selenium模擬用戶操作,驅動瀏覽器與MQTT服務端交互,結合MQTT客戶端庫實現消息的自動化收發(fā)與驗證,構建覆蓋全流程的測試閉環(huán)。
物聯網設備的通信協議的選擇直接決定了系統的可靠性、功耗與擴展性。MQTT與CoAP作為兩大主流輕量級協議,前者憑借發(fā)布/訂閱模式支撐起智能家居的復雜聯動,后者以UDP基礎上的RESTful設計成為傳感器網絡的理想選擇。本文將從協議架構、搭建實踐、性能優(yōu)化三個維度展開對比,為不同場景提供技術選型指南。
在物聯網設備數量突破百億的今天,MQTT協議憑借其輕量化設計、高效傳輸和靈活擴展性,已成為連接智能設備的核心通信協議。從智能家居到工業(yè)互聯網,從車聯網到遠程醫(yī)療,MQTT正以每秒處理百萬級消息的吞吐能力,支撐著萬物互聯時代的通信需求。